Homes for sale in 75238 are located in one of the most established and recognizable residential areas of Northeast Dallas, commonly associated with Lake Highlands and areas near White Rock Lake. The 75238 zip code lies entirely within Dallas, Texas, and Dallas County, and includes several well-known neighborhoods that consistently attract buyers looking for traditional housing, mature landscapes, and convenient access to both East and North Dallas.
With approximately 7,500–9,500 homes and an estimated population of 22,000–25,000 residents, 75238 offers a broad mix of housing options ranging from mid-century ranch homes to renovated properties and selective new construction. Buyers searching for 75238 homes for sale are often drawn to the area’s established character, proximity to outdoor amenities, and strong long-term demand within Northeast Dallas.
The 75238 zip code is located in Northeast Dallas, north of White Rock Lake and east of Central Expressway.

Homes in 75238 were primarily built between:
1950s–1970s: Original ranch and mid-century homes
1980s–1990s: Limited additional development
2000s–Present: Renovations and selective new construction
Homes for sale in 75238 typically range from:
1,400–2,000 sq ft for original homes
2,000–2,800 sq ft for renovated or expanded properties
2,500–3,500+ sq ft for newer construction
Common layouts include:
3–4 bedrooms
2–3 bathrooms
Multiple living spaces
Optional home office or flex rooms
Lot sizes are larger than many central Dallas areas:
0.20–0.35 acres typical
Larger lots available in select Lake Highlands neighborhoods
